			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2>Visual Art Exchange</h2>
<p><img class="alignleft" style="border: 4px solid black; margin: 10px;" src="http://www.ljonesdesign.com/images/acornattic.jpg" border="4" alt="" hspace="10" vspace="10" width="200" height="301" align="right" /> <img class="alignright" style="border: 4px solid black; margin: 10px;" src="http://www.ljonesdesign.com/images/eggtrike.jpg" border="4" alt="" hspace="10" vspace="10" width="200" height="133" align="left" />I submitted two pieces of artwork for the &#8220;Unfettered&#8221; exhibition at the <a href="http://www.visualartexchange.org/" target="_blank">Visual Art Exchange</a>, in Downtown Raleigh, April 6-24. The one that was accepted was my <a href="http://acornatticantiques.com/index.htm" target="_blank">Acorn Attic Antiques</a> photo (left), taken in Wilmington.</p>
<p align="left">When I saw the dolphin, I was reminded of  <a href="http://www.egglestontrust.com/" target="_blank">William Eggleston&#8217;s</a> tricycle image. It took me a long time to learn to appreciate his work because it is so stark and dispassionate. So it is a bit ironic that my first-ever photo accepted into a significantly competitive show was inspired by Eggleston, and is not very indicative of the majority of my work.</p>
<p><img class="alignright" style="border: 4px solid black; margin: 10px;" src="http://www.ljonesdesign.com/images/bbeach.jpg" border="4" alt="" hspace="10" vspace="10" width="300" height="200" align="right" />At right, is the other photo I submitted, but was not chosen. I took it on the Brighton Beach Pier in England at sundown. I thought that this picture was a bit quirkier and would get in the show before the other one, but I have since learned that it is not always easy to predict what will capture a juror&#8217;s attention.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://www.ljonesdesign.com/images/breaking_free.gif" border="0" alt="" width="313" height="400" align="right" /><em>Breaking Free</em>, Linoleum Cut Print, Edition of 20, $50 unframed. Breaking free was inspired by Picasso and the German Expressionists and was selected for inclusion in the Emulous Exhibition at the Visual Art Exchange, in Raleigh.</p>
<p>Exhibition details:</p>
<p><strong>Emulous (desirous of equaling or excelling)</strong><br />
<strong>June 6-27, 2008</strong><br />
<strong>First Friday Reception: </strong>June 6, 6-9pm<br />
This exhibition will be filled with the work of famous artists &#8211; recreated by local artists. A tradition in formal art training, reproducing the work of masters is a great way to learn their technique. Artists can mimic an existing work or create original work in the style of their favorite master artist.<br />
<em><strong>Juried.</strong></em></p>
